sm 기술 블로그

61. 소수(2581) 본문

문제/백준_자바스크립트

61. 소수(2581)

sm_hope 2022. 6. 3. 10:44
let input = require("fs").readFileSync("ex.txt").toString().trim().split("\n");

let M = parseInt(input[0]);
let N = parseInt(input[1]);

let arr = [];
let sum = 0;

for (let i = M; i <= N; i++) {
  cnt = 0;

  if (i == 1) {
    continue;
  }

  for (let j = 1; j <= i; j++) {
    if (i % j == 0) {
      cnt++;
    }
  }

  if (cnt == 2) {
    arr.push(i);
    sum += i;
  }
}

if (sum != 0) {
  console.log(sum + "\n" + Math.min(...arr));
} else {
  console.log(-1);
}

자바스크립트에서 ...은 배열이라는 것을 알려주는 거다.

'문제 > 백준_자바스크립트' 카테고리의 다른 글

63. 1929(소수 구하기)  (0) 2022.06.04
62. 11653(소인수분해)  (0) 2022.06.04
60. 1978(소수찾기)  (0) 2022.06.03
59. 10757(큰 수 더하기)  (0) 2022.05.31
58. 2839(설탕배달)  (0) 2022.05.30
Comments